WebWe do not charge you for issuing cheques to payees in other countries. However if we are receiving funds via a foreign cheque or draft then charges would apply. These charges are as follows: £100 or under is a £5 charge. £100.01 - £5000 is a £10.00 charge. £5000.01 - £20000 is a £30.00 charge. Above £20000 is a £60.00 charge.
